Quick Summary
This discussion clarifies whether interior, furnishing, and electronics costs incurred in 2016 can be added to the original purchase price of a flat when calculating capital gains tax. While full contractor VAT bills are ideal, payments made via cheque can be partially considered as part of the property's cost base, with or without indexation benefits.
